The Dreamville camp releases the official video for “Don’t Hit Me Right Now’ featuring Bas, Cozz, Yung Baby Tate, Buddy, and Guapdad 4000.
Directed by Tyler Sobel-Mason, the perfect song for social distancing gets the visual treatment. The music video takes a simple yet effective approach of highlighting each artist without special effects. The camera zooms in-and-out, switches angles, and captures each personality in multiple modern settings.
The Grammy-nominated Revenge Of The Dreamers III earned many of the aforementioned artists not only their first award nomination, but also their first platinum record. The album received 12 new tracks on the deluxe version, of which Ari Lennox’s “BUSSIT” served up a sultry video.
